Diving into A2A: The Nuts and Bolts

Let’s break it down, shall we? At its core, A2A adopts a client-server model. Think of it like a project manager (the “client agent”) delegating tasks to a remote worker (the “remote agent”). So, how does this dance unfold? Here are the key moves:

  1. Capability Discovery: Agent Cards, embodied in a neat JSON format, let agents flaunt their skills and metadata. This essential step allows the client agent to seek out the most suitable helpers for the job—a genius matchmaking system if you will.
  2. Task Management: Tasks are the bread and butter of A2A. The protocol sets the stage for agents to communicate effectively about task lifecycle—from “hey, just submitted this” to “task complete, how’s that for efficiency?”
  3. Message Exchange and Collaboration: Agents get to chat back and forth about a task’s context. It’s not just any old messaging; they’re talking specifics—like data chunks in bite-sized “parts,” which could be text, images, or who knows, even video clips!
  4. User Experience Negotiation: Just like artists negotiating creative differences, client and remote agents work out how best to present info to humans. Picture a delightful menu of formats—from text to videos to interactive forms.

Classover Secures U.S. Trademark, Aims to Boost IP and AI Development

**Classover: Charting a Bold Course in Education with its New U.S. Trademark**

Imagine a realm where education isn’t just a mundane routine but a thrilling voyage, brimming with interactivity and powered by artificial intelligence. Enter Classover, the trailblazing maestro of live, online learning experiences. Recently, this innovative platform hit a huge milestone by securing its trademark from the United States Patent and Trademark Office (USPTO). So, what’s in it for the future of education, and how does Classover plan to make waves with this shiny new badge of honor? Buckle up, because we’re about to dive into a sea of exciting possibilities.

Now, let’s unwrap the essence of Classover. Classover Holdings, Inc., trading on Nasdaq with the symbols KIDZ and KIDZW, is not just your run-of-the-mill educational entity; it’s a vision to transform how we absorb and interact with educational content! Operating through its wholly-owned subsidiary, Class Over Inc., the mission of Classover is crystal clear: to shake up the traditional learning model with a dynamic blend of human instruction and AI prowess. This fusion aims to craft an educational playground where real-time feedback and tailored instruction reign supreme, making learning not just effective, but genuinely enjoyable.

Ah, but let’s not get too lost in the clouds—what’s the big deal with securing a trademark? Well, receiving that coveted U.S. trademark isn’t just some bureaucratic step; it represents a substantial leap for Classover. Imagine this as a superhero cape: it shields Classover’s brand rights across its educational offerings, cementing its status as a heavyweight in the realm of AI-driven tutoring platforms. The maze of trademark applications can be a drawn-out affair, typically spanning nine to eighteen months, thanks to complexities and possible objections from other existing trademarks. So, the fact that Classover navigated this legal labyrinth without a hitch is no small feat; it’s a definite sign of their serious market intent.

With the trademark in their corner, the future looks as bright as a classroom filled with eager students ready to learn. Classover is gearing up to ramp up its intellectual property and AI capabilities with a multi-faceted strategy:

1. **Acquiring Educational Technology Platforms:** They’re eyeing platforms that can bolster their tech arsenal, integrating cutting-edge AI tools that promise to enhance user experiences. Think of it like a chef gathering the finest ingredients to whip up a culinary masterpiece!

2. **Building Proprietary Training Datasets:** With over 300,000 hours of live learning sessions already tucked under their belts, Classover isn’t stopping there. They’re on a mission to expand this treasure trove of data, collecting more recorded lessons and educational content. This isn’t just busywork—this database is vital for crafting their AI tutors into personalized mentors with a human touch.

3. **Mergers and Acquisitions:** Classover is sniffing out established brands and burgeoning educational ventures that resonate with their K-12 and supplementary learning goals. This approach is like creating a superhero team, where each new member enhances the powers of the collective, augmenting their educational ecosystem.
